Dogs make absolutely wonderful pets. They are faithful, loyal and provide unconditional love. They are also a ton of fun to play with. As a responsible dog owner, it is important that you educate yourself on proper dog care. Utilize the dog care tips outlined in this article to keep your pooch healthy and happy for many years.

If you are looking for a great family pet, but are on a budget, consider rescuing an animal.You can get one at a local shelter for minimal costs and the dog will come with a clean bill of health and all his shots. If you are interested in a specific breed, contact a rescue group specializing in only those pooches.

Giving your dog a bath is essential to his health. Depending on his size and activity level, toss him in the tub weekly or monthly and always use a shampoo that is made for dogs and is pH balanced. Pets have different pH levels than humans and a good dog shampoo will leave your canine clean with a beautiful shiny coat.

When you have medications of any sort, keep them where your dog cannot get to it. If your dog ingests your medications, it could be fatal. Make sure you have your veterinarian's number handy in case your dog does accidentally swallow your medicine.

When you get a new dog, schedule a visit with a vet. In fact, do it the same day as you bring the pet home so you don't forget. Your vet can make health recommendations, make sure that vaccinations are up to date and help with maintenance items like flea care and proper diet. Also discuss the spaying or neutering process with your vet. This can help to eliminate unwanted animals and keep your dog happy and healthy for a longer period of time.

Invest in a separate tub if your dog gets frequent baths. Buy a large metal basin where you will have plenty of room to scrub, but won't risk clogging the pipes in your bathroom. Giving him a bath outside and away from the slipperiness of a porcelain tub is also safer for you

Carefully pick the foods you feed your dog. There are many options, but you should match your dog to food that was made for his age and size. While some choose to feed their dogs table scraps, this is not the best way to ensure that all of a dog's health needs are being met.

Dogs will commonly get cut when they're walking because of the various debris on the ground. If your dog happens to get a cut, wash it thoroughly and put a bandage on it. If the cut is relatively deep, bring your dog to the vet.

When engaged in dog training, stick to the methods that use positive reinforcement. Do not hit your dog as this will only make him fear you. Humane training is better for years to come and it's more effective. Always treat your dog with kindness during training so you will see a much better end result.

When you first start training, play with different reward systems. Trying different techniques can help you find one that really clicks with your dog's learning style. If find that your dog is motivated by food, a hot dog, cut into small pieces, is a great reward. Tug of war is a great game that you can play with your dog as a reward. Certain dogs just need love and affection whenever they behave.

If your dog seems to be struggling with learning commands, consider getting a clicker. A clicker is a tool that is useful when training as it teaches your pup that when he does something correctly, a click will happen which is immediately followed by a reward. Clicker training can be helpful for teaching commands, tricks, and walking manners.
